ameO <br /> SECTION 02777.0 GEOTEXTILE <br /> PART L GENERAL <br /> 1.01 SUMMARY <br /> This SPECIFICATION describes requirements for the manufacture, supply, and installation of the geotextile <br /> in the Underdrains, and Leak Detection System, as shown on the DRAWINGS; and construction quality <br /> control monitoring. All procedures, operations, and methods shall be in strict compliance with the <br /> SPECIFICATIONS,the Construction Quality Assurance Plan,and the DRAWINGS. <br /> 1.02 SUBMITTALS <br /> A. Submittals with Bid Documents <br /> CONTRACTOR shall provide the following information relating to the geotextile <br /> MANUFACTURER with its proposal. <br /> 1. Information from MANUFACTURER including company name, address, telephone <br /> number,the names of the company president and quality control manager, and narrative of <br /> the company history. <br /> 2. Description of MANUFACTURER's manufacturing capabilities: <br /> a. Information on plant size, equipment, personnel, number of shifts per day, and <br /> capacity per shift. <br /> b. A list of standard material properties and test methods employed to arrive at the <br /> values for each. As a minimum,the list shall include properties given in Part 2 of <br /> this Section. <br /> 3. The Quality Control Manual followed during the manufacturing process including those for <br /> the polymer material and for detecting foreign objects in the finished goods, and a <br /> description of the quality control laboratory facilities, including the name and telephone <br /> number of the quality control manager. Upon review of the Quality Control Manual, the <br /> MANAGER and CERTIFYING ENGINEER may request additional testing during the <br /> manufacturing process at no additional cost to CC&V. <br /> B. CONTRACTOR shall provide the following information after contract award but within ten (10) <br /> days prior to material arrival on-site and prior to commencement of the work: <br /> 1. The geotextile MANUFACTURER shall provide written certification that the geotextile to <br /> be used meets the requirements of the Mill Site Earthworks project and has been <br /> continuously inspected for the presence of needles and geotextile was found to be needle <br /> free. <br /> 2. A copy of the MANUFACTURER's geotextile QC test results of properties outlined in <br /> Part 2 of this Section. The MANAGER reserves the right to refuse use of any geotextile <br /> supplied without the proper QC documentation. <br /> Section 02777 Page 1 of 5 May 9,2012 <br /> Geotextile Revision 1 <br />
